    The GLP-1 Problem No One Is Talking About: A New Metabolic Approach

    GLP-1 receptor agonists have transformed weight loss and metabolic health—but what are we overlooking? In this episode of New Frontiers in Functional Medicine, Dr. Kara Fitzgerald is joined by Dr. Sanjay Bhojraj and Dr. Alexis Gonzales to explore the clinical tradeoffs of GLP-1 therapy, including lean muscle preservation, nutrient status, weight regain, and long-term metabolic health. The conversation also examines SiPore, an engineered silica-based intervention that works locally in the GI tract to slow the breakdown and absorption of carbohydrates and fats. Dr. Fitzgerald and her guests discuss findings from the rand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led SHINE trial, including outcomes related to A1c, visceral fat, waist circumference, cholesterol, and lean mass. They also explore how CGMs can reveal post-meal glucose patterns, why muscle preservation matters during weight loss, and how clinicians can support patients transitioning off GLP-1 medications—including those preparing for pregnancy, IVF, or surgery.     Why Chronic Disease May Begin Before Birth

    In this episode of New Frontiers in Functional Medicine, Dr. Kara Fitzgerald is joined by Dr. Emily Stone Rydbom, Dr. Leslie Stone, and Dr. Kalea Wattles to explore the science of preconception health, fertility, epigenetics, and chronic disease prevention. Learn how maternal nutrition, mitochondrial health, methylation, the microbiome, inflammation, and environmental exposures influence fertility, pregnancy outcomes, and lifelong health through the Developmental Origins of Health and Disease (DOHaD) framework. Topics include: • Why chronic disease risk may begin before conception • Epigenetics, methylation, folate, and MTHFR • Mitochondrial health and fertility • Functional medicine approaches to infertility and pregnancy • The future of AI and precision medicine in reproductive healthcare Whether you're a healthcare practitioner, planning a pregnancy, or simply interested in functional medicine and precision health, this episode offers practical, science-backed insights into improving health across generations.     The Skin Longevity Breakthrough | Carolina Reis Oliveira

    Can skincare influence healthy aging beyond reducing fine lines and wrinkles? In this episode of New Frontiers in Functional Medicine, Dr. Kara Fitzgerald welcomes Carolina Reis Oliveira, PhD, CEO and co-founder of OneSkin, for a science-based discussion on cellular senescence, skin aging, and the connection between skin health and longevity. Carolina explains the research behind OneSkin's OS-01 peptide, developed after screening more than 900 peptides to identify one that targets senescent ("zombie") cells. These aging cells contribute to inflammation, collagen loss, impaired skin barrier function, and visible skin aging. Together, they explore the latest research on biological skin age, skin inflammation, barrier repair, collagen production, sensitive skin, retinol, microneedling, hair thinning, scar recovery, and the effects of GLP-1–associated weight loss on skin health. They also discuss why testing complete skincare formulations matters and how longevity science is shaping the future of skincare. Whether you're a clinician, skincare professional, or simply interested in healthy aging, this episode offers an evidence-informed look at where longevity science and skincare intersect.     How Medicine Got Menopause Wrong | Dr. Kelly Casperson

    Hormones are about far more than hot flashes. In this episode of New Frontiers in Functional Medicine, Dr. Kara Fitzgerald is joined by urologist and hormone expert Dr. Kelly Casperson for a conversation that challenges conventional thinking about menopause, hormone replacement therapy (HRT), and healthy aging. Dr. Casperson explains why menopause may be better understood as a form of hypogonadism, shares the story behind the removal of the FDA's black box warning on vaginal estrogen, and explores the latest evidence on estrogen, progesterone, and testosterone therapy for women. Topics include: • Vaginal estrogen and the FDA black box warning • The lasting impact of the Women's Health Initiative (WHI) • Estrogen, brain health, and mitochondrial function • Testosterone therapy for women: science and misconceptions • Hormone therapy after age 60 • Patient education, body literacy, and informed decision-making • Exercise, sleep, alcohol reduction, and other foundations of healthy aging Whether you're a functional medicine practitioner or someone interested in menopause, longevity, and women's health, this evidence-based conversation offers practical insights and a fresh perspective on hormone care.     The Infection Driving Chronic Illness | Dr. Richard Horowitz

    In this episode of New Frontiers in Functional Medicine, Richard Horowitz joins Kara Fitzgerald to explore the connection between persistent infections, inflammation, and chronic disease. The discussion highlights emerging research linking Borrelia burgdorferi (Lyme disease) to amyloid production and Alzheimer’s biomarkers, along with the clinical implications of Dr. Horowitz’s MSIDS model. Topics include biofilm persistence, co-infections, treatment resistance, and multi-targeted strategies for addressing complex, chronic conditions such as Lyme disease, ME/CFS, fibromyalgia, and long COVID. This episode offers clinicians a more integrated framework for evaluating and managing treatment-resistant patients.
